Transaction 359479250bb115a6f36f1e2db9e4551dce8340e66f7933d962329ec890c5eb94
1 Input
1 Output
-
359479250bb115a6f36f1e2db9e4551dce8340e66f7933d962329ec890c5eb94:0
- value
- 320380
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 774c5c19295ede886c5b74c5f32b06246caaf094 OP_EQUAL
- address
- 3CZoowWZKDCTMtSyeKjfPUw7KpfV2DFbNp